Handover note — Crumbwheel order cutoffs.

Welcome aboard. The bakery cutoff rule in Crumbwheel closes same-day orders at 14:00 local to each storefront, not UTC — this has bitten us twice. Holiday overrides live in the calendar service and take precedence silently, so always check there first when a cutoff looks wrong. To unlock the calendar service's admin console after a restart, enter the recovery passphrase below.

vault phrase of bagap-bahaf = silion-pelox-sorox-casdor-quenwyn-fraax-eliox-praael-kelion-quenvan-kasox-rusael-norius-belvan

**Ticket: Drift detected in Inkwell spooler config**

For the weekly sync: the Inkwell print-spooler microservice in the Fenport cluster has drifted from its declared manifest. Retry intervals and the max-queue-depth setting differ from what's in source control, likely from a live hotfix during the October paper-jam incident that was never backported. The values currently running in production are listed below.

settings of bafof-fajog:
[aldix]
port = 9300
region = north-3
host = aldix.kelvilabs.example
team = istath
timeout_ms = 1500
retries = 8

Welcome to on-call for the Glimmerpane design system! Our snapshot tests live in the `snapcheck` suite and run on every merge to main. If a UI component changes visually, the diff bot flags it — usually it's an intentional tweak, so just approve the new baseline. If it's 2am and snapshots are failing across the board, it's almost always a font-loading race, not your problem. To unlock the baseline store and re-approve snapshots in bulk, use the recovery passphrase below.

recovery phrase for tahag-taguf: wenix-caswyn

**FAQ: What do I do when Pingloom fan-out backs up?**

Short version: don't panic. When the Pingloom notifier queue exceeds its backpressure threshold, deliveries slow but nothing is lost. Usually it clears itself in ten minutes. If it doesn't, you can flush the stuck dispatcher from the ops console — but the console locks during overload, by design. To unlock it, enter the recovery passphrase shown below.

recovery phrase for fawif-tajeg: norael-aldmir-casir-brivan-ulaion